For her 1L summer, Dorronda will be working in Beijing, China at the Beijing Children’s Legal Aid and Research Center (BCLARC). BCLARC is a subsidiary of the Zhicheng Public Interest Lawyers group, one of the few legal NGOs in China. BCLARC specializes in the protection of children’s rights and provides free legal assistance to those who lack the financial means. As an intern, Dorronda’s duties include legal research for cases and projects on legal reform, translating, organizing lectures and workshops, and assisting in the annual International Student Forum on Public Interest law in Beijing.
